Technical Field

[0001] This application relates to the field of nuclear reactor fuel rod cladding experimental technology, and in particular to a method, apparatus, equipment, storage medium and product for simulating cladding tube explosion. Background Technology

[0002] With the development of nuclear reactor fuel rod cladding experimental technology, rapid pressurization and detonation tests are generally used to simulate reactive accidents. These tests examine the impact of different pressurization rates on the pressure-bearing capacity of candidate cladding materials under specific high-temperature conditions, thereby screening for cladding materials with potential applications and providing valuable reference for predicting their subsequent thermodynamic behavior upon reactor insertion. Rapid pressurization and detonation tests are typically conducted in a high-temperature furnace. The test sample is placed in the homogenization zone of the furnace, sealed at one end, and connected to a pressurization device at the other. Once the furnace temperature reaches the preset level, the pressurization device is pre-pressurized. Ensuring uniform temperature across the entire sample, the pressure relief valve is opened, resulting in a rapid pressurization and detonation test, ultimately yielding the pressure-time curve. After the test, other cladding parameters, such as elongation, can be measured to characterize the cladding toughness.

[0003] In traditional techniques, burst tests on cladding tubes require different combinations of temperatures and pressurization rates for tubes made of different materials. This results in numerous testing conditions for different cladding tube materials. Consequently, a large number of cladding tubes are needed for burst tests, and each tube is damaged after each test and cannot be reused, leading to a significant waste of resources. [0063] One method is to simulate a reactive introduction accident in the cladding tubes using a pressure boosting burst test, thereby examining the pressure-bearing capacity of cladding tubes made of different materials. A reactive introduction accident occurs when a nuclear reactor accidentally introduces positive reactivity under various operating conditions, leading to a surge in reactor power, instantaneous pressurization inside the cladding tubes, and eventual rupture.

[0064] Cladding tubes are used in nuclear engineering. Nuclear reactors use fissile materials, which are then processed into metals, alloys, oxides, carbides, etc., to serve as reactor fuel. To prevent the leakage of these fission products, the fuel is typically encased in a cladding. The cladding tube contains these fission products, preventing direct contact and reaction between the fuel and the external coolant. Cladding tubes generally operate in high-temperature, high-pressure environments, constantly bearing increasing stress. This stress comes from both the pressure and thermal stress of the external coolant and the internal stress caused by fuel fission. Therefore, the requirements for cladding tube materials in nuclear engineering are extremely high.

[0077] S270, obtain the geometric and material parameters of the cladding tube.

[0078] The geometric parameters of the cladding tube include its length, axial length, cross-sectional thickness, outer diameter, and ellipticity. The material parameters of the cladding tube include its material, density, elastic parameters, plastic parameters, creep parameters, and fracture parameters, which are directly related to the material properties of the selected cladding tube. Elastic parameters include elastic modulus and Poisson's ratio, plastic parameters include yield strength, and fracture parameters include ultimate stress, ultimate strain, and strain energy.

[0079] Specifically, the geometric parameters of the aforementioned cladding tube can be obtained through measurement, and the material parameters of the aforementioned cladding tube can be obtained directly through simple experiments or by referring to material handbooks.

[0080] S280. Based on the geometric and material parameters of the cladding tube, establish the geometric model of the cladding tube.

[0081] Specifically, before conducting a simulated pressure-boosting explosion experiment on the cladding tube, it is necessary to first establish a geometric model corresponding to the cladding tube. This geometric model can be established based on the cladding tube's geometric and material parameters. Methods such as boundary representation, solid geometry construction, and hybrid representation can be employed.

[0082] S290, the geometric model of the cladding tube is meshed using the finite element method to obtain the meshed finite element model, which is then used as the virtual model corresponding to the cladding tube.

[0083] After establishing the geometric model of the cladding tube, the finite element method (FEM) is used to process the geometric model and generate its finite element model. Specifically, firstly, the element types and material properties of the geometric model are defined. Element types can be categorized by dimension into one-dimensional, two-dimensional, and three-dimensional elements. One-dimensional elements include rod and beam elements, two-dimensional elements include shell and planar elements, and three-dimensional elements include solid elements and thick shell elements. The element type can be selected based on the problem the finite element model needs to solve. Specifically, solid elements can be chosen as the element type for the geometric model, as they possess plasticity, hyperelasticity, and large deformation capabilities, making them suitable for simulating the deformation of elastic materials. Other element types that can be selected include solid elements, shell elements, and continuous shell elements. The material properties of the geometric model are defined as the material parameters of the cladding tube.

[0084] Secondly, according to the element type and material properties of the defined geometric model, the geometric model of the cladding tube is meshed to obtain the meshed finite element model. Specifically, the geometric model of the cladding tube can be meshed according to surface meshes to generate triangular or quadrilateral meshes; based on the generated triangular or quadrilateral meshes, the meshed finite element model is obtained. Alternatively, the geometric model of the cladding tube can be meshed according to volume meshes to generate tetrahedral or hexahedral meshes; based on the generated tetrahedral or hexahedral meshes, the meshed finite element model is obtained.

[0085] Finally, the meshed finite element model is used as the virtual model corresponding to the cladding tube. For example... Figure 4 The diagram shown is a schematic representation of the virtual model corresponding to the cladding tube in one embodiment. The virtual model corresponding to the cladding tube is a finite element model of the cladding tube. This finite element model includes multiple hexahedral meshes 420 obtained by meshing the geometric model of the cladding tube based on a volume mesh. The node and element numbering rules of the mesh can be input using third-party software or implemented through coding.

[0086] In this embodiment, the geometric and material parameters of the cladding tube are obtained, and a geometric model of the cladding tube is established based on these parameters. The geometric model of the cladding tube is meshed using the finite element method (FEM), resulting in a meshed FEM model. This meshed FEM model serves as the virtual model corresponding to the cladding tube. Establishing the geometric model of the cladding tube based on its geometric and material parameters allows for a realistic reconstruction of its geometric structure. The purpose of meshing a complex geometric model using the FEM is to replace a continuous geometric body with a finite number of discrete elements, ultimately dividing a complex geometric model into several simpler models. Therefore, using the FEM to mesh the geometric model of the cladding tube improves the accuracy of the resulting virtual model. Ultimately, this improves the accuracy of subsequent cladding tube blasting simulation experiments based on the virtual model.

[0087] In one embodiment, such as Figure 5 As shown, in S240 above, a pressure load is applied to the virtual model corresponding to the cladding tube according to the pressure boosting explosion test parameters to conduct a cladding tube explosion simulation experiment and generate pressure boosting explosion simulation parameters, including:

[0088] S520, at the experimental temperature, a preset pressure load is applied to the inner wall of the virtual model corresponding to the cladding tube to generate the simulation parameters of the cladding tube under the preset pressure load; the simulation parameters of the cladding tube include the deformation of the inner wall of the cladding tube, the deformation of the outer wall, and the stress value of each grid of the cladding tube.

[0089] Among them, the deformation of the inner wall and the deformation of the outer wall of the cladding tube are the changes in the inner and outer diameters of the cladding tube under the preset pressure load, and the stress value of each grid of the cladding tube is the value of the internal force generated by the interaction of various parts inside the cladding tube when the cladding tube is subjected to pressure load.

[0090] Specifically, fixed boundary conditions will be applied to both ends of the cladding tube to simulate the constraint conditions at both ends of the cladding tube in a real pressure boosting explosion experiment. When the overall simulation experimental environment temperature reaches the set temperature, one end of the cladding tube will be sealed, and the inner wall of the cladding tube will be pressurized from the other end to generate the pressure boosting explosion simulation parameters generated during the pressure boosting process.

[0091] When conducting pressure-boosting explosion tests on cladding tubes, different cladding tubes made of different materials need to be tested under different pressure-boosting explosion test parameters. Each cladding tube made of different materials corresponds to a specific test condition under different pressure-boosting explosion test parameters. Therefore, when conducting pressure-boosting explosion tests on cladding tubes, there are many test conditions required for cladding tubes made of different materials.

[0092] When selecting a finite element method (FEM) solver, the first step is to determine whether inertial force plays a dominant role in the pressure-boosting blasting simulation experiment based on the load-time correlation (i.e., the pressure-time curve). If it is determined that inertial force plays a dominant role, a dynamic analysis solver is used to obtain the pressure-boosting blasting parameters for any part of the geometric model. Conversely, a static analysis solver is used to obtain the pressure-boosting blasting parameters for any part of the geometric model.

[0093] S540, if the pressure load on the inner wall of the cladding tube is less than the maximum pressure load, determine whether the deformation of the inner wall and the outer wall of the cladding tube are less than the maximum deformation; if not, proceed to step 580 and end the explosion simulation experiment.

[0094] S560, if the deformation of the inner wall and the outer wall of the cladding tube are less than the maximum deformation and the pressure load on the inner wall of the cladding tube is less than the maximum pressure load, determine whether the cladding tube has fractured based on the stress value of each grid of the cladding tube; if so, proceed to step 580 and end the blasting simulation experiment.

[0095] The fracture phenomenon refers to the fracture that occurs when the cladding material is subjected to stress exceeding its fracture strength, which is the stress value at which the cladding material fractures.

[0096] The stress value used to determine the fracture phenomenon of the inner wall of the cladding tube can be obtained by referring to the fracture parameters in the material parameters of the cladding tube.

[0097] S570, if not, then adjust the preset pressure load according to the pressurization rate to obtain the adjusted preset pressure load. Use the adjusted preset pressure load as the new preset pressure load, and repeatedly execute the step of applying the preset pressure load to the inner wall of the virtual model corresponding to the cladding tube to generate the pressurization explosion simulation parameters of the cladding tube under the preset pressure load, until the stress value of each grid of the cladding tube in the pressurization explosion simulation parameters determines that the cladding tube has fractured. Then output the pressurization explosion simulation parameters of the cladding tube under multiple preset pressure loads.

[0098] Specifically, if no fracture occurs, the pressure applied to the inner wall of the cladding tube continues to increase according to the pressurization rate, the stress value of the cladding tube is updated, and the pressurization explosion simulation parameters at this moment are calculated until the cladding tube fractures, at which point the calculation ends and the pressurization explosion simulation parameters at each moment are output.

[0099] In this embodiment, a preset pressure load is applied to the inner wall of the virtual model corresponding to the cladding tube to generate simulation parameters for the cladding tube under the preset pressure load. The stress value of each grid of the cladding tube is used to determine whether the cladding tube has fractured. If not, the preset pressure load is adjusted according to the pressurization rate to obtain the adjusted preset pressure load. The adjusted preset pressure load is used as the new preset pressure load. The steps of applying the preset pressure load to the inner wall of the virtual model corresponding to the cladding tube and generating simulation parameters for the cladding tube under the preset pressure load are repeated until the stress value of each grid of the cladding tube in the simulation parameters for the cladding tube determines that the cladding tube has fractured. Then, the simulation parameters for the cladding tube under multiple preset pressure loads are output. Traditional experiments can only obtain the deformation at the final moment, thus failing to acquire some intermediate quantities in the pressure-boosting explosion experiment. However, this scheme uses virtual experiments to obtain real-time pressure-boosting explosion simulation parameters of the cladding tube, including the deformation of the inner wall of the cladding tube, the deformation of the outer wall, and the stress values ​​of each grid of the cladding tube. It can obtain the deformation and stress values ​​of the cladding tube as the pressure-boosting rate changes, which is convenient for analyzing the cladding tube's ability to withstand high temperature and high pressure.

[0100] In one embodiment, such as Figure 6 As shown, S560 above determines whether the cladding tube has fractured based on the stress values ​​of each grid in the cladding tube, including:

[0101] S562, determine whether the cladding tube has yielded based on the stress values ​​of each grid in the cladding tube;

[0102] Yielding refers to the phenomenon where, when the stress exceeds the elastic limit, the material continues to undergo significant plastic deformation even when the external force no longer increases. The minimum stress value at which yielding occurs is called the yield point. The yield point can be found in the yield strength parameters of the cladding tube material. Specifically, the finite element method (FEM) is used to determine whether yielding has occurred on the inner wall of the cladding tube based on the stress values ​​of each mesh.

[0103] S564, If not, calculate the first deformation of the inner wall of the cladding tube and the first deformation of the outer wall; the first deformation includes the elastic deformation.

[0104] At this point, the deformation of the inner wall and the outer wall of the cladding tube are the first deformation. If no yielding occurs, the deformation of the cladding tube is only elastic deformation, and the deformation only includes elastic deformation. Specifically, the first deformation of the inner and outer walls of the cladding tube is calculated using a finite element solver.

[0105] S566, if so, calculate the second deformation of the inner wall and the second deformation of the outer wall of the casing tube, and determine whether the casing tube has fractured; the second deformation includes elastic deformation and plastic deformation.

[0106] Plastic deformation is mainly caused by creep, which is a phenomenon where the deformation increases over time. Plastic deformation, on the other hand, is inelastic and does not return to its original shape after the external force is removed. If yielding occurs, the deformation of the cladding tube includes not only elastic deformation but also plastic deformation. The deformation of the inner wall of the cladding tube includes both elastic and plastic deformation; the sum of these is the total deformation. In this case, the deformation of the inner and outer walls of the cladding tube constitutes the second deformation. Specifically, the second deformation of the inner and outer walls of the cladding tube is calculated using a finite element method (FEM).

[0107] In this embodiment, the stress values ​​of each grid in the cladding tube are used to determine whether the cladding tube has yielded. If not, the first deformation of the inner and outer walls of the cladding tube is calculated, including elastic deformation. If yes, the second deformation of the inner and outer walls of the cladding tube is calculated, and it is determined whether the cladding tube has fractured. The second deformation includes both elastic and plastic deformation. The calculated first and second deformations characterize the deformation of the cladding tube against high temperature and high pressure, and have certain reference value for predicting the thermodynamic behavior of the cladding tube after it is loaded into the reactor.

[0108] In one embodiment, the aforementioned preset constraint condition further includes the yield point of the cladding tube; S562, determining whether the cladding tube has yielded based on the stress values ​​of each grid of the cladding tube, includes:

[0109] Compare the stress values ​​of each grid in the cladding tube with the yield point of the cladding tube;

[0110] Determine whether the cladding tube has yielded based on its size relationship.

[0111] Specifically, if the stress values ​​of each mesh in the cladding tube are less than the yield point of the cladding tube, then no yielding has occurred, and the deformation of the cladding tube remains elastic, exhibiting elastic deformation. If the stress values ​​of each mesh in the cladding tube are greater than the yield point, then yielding has occurred, and the cladding tube exhibits plastic deformation. Specifically, the finite element method (FEM) solver determines whether the cladding tube has yielded based on whether the stress values ​​of each mesh exceed the yield point.

[0112] In this embodiment, the stress values ​​of each grid in the cladding tube are compared with the yield point of the cladding tube; based on this relationship, it is determined whether the cladding tube has yielded. Yielding is one of the manifestations of material properties and has a significant impact on the material's practical applications. Therefore, determining the yield of the cladding tube is an important step in subsequent material capability analysis.

[0118] S266. Based on the first and second correspondences, calculate the pressure resistance time and cross-sectional elongation of the cladding tube.

[0119] Among them, the pressure resistance time of the cladding tube is the time from the application of pressure load to the fracture of the cladding tube, and the cross-sectional elongation rate is the percentage of the initial perimeter of the cladding tube to the increase in perimeter after the pressure boosting and bursting test. It is an important parameter representing the toughness and plastic deformation or creep deformation of the cladding tube.

[0120] Specifically, the pressure resistance time and cross-sectional elongation of the cladding tube can be calculated using a finite element method. [0132] Combination Figure 11 As shown, the analysis module first reads the initial pressure load at the initial time (t=0), obtaining the initial elastic deformation of the inner and outer walls of the cladding tube and the stress values ​​of each grid in the cladding tube under the initial pressure load. Second, it continuously updates the pressure load, obtaining the deformation of the inner and outer walls of the cladding tube and the stress values ​​of each grid in the cladding tube at each updated pressure load (assuming the previous update time was t=0, then t=0+dt at this time). Finally, it determines whether the stress values ​​of each grid in the cladding tube reach the yield point. If the stress values ​​of each grid in the cladding tube reach the yield point, it is determined that the cladding tube has undergone plastic deformation. In this case, when calculating the total deformation of the inner wall of the cladding tube, the sum of the elastic and plastic deformation needs to be calculated. If the stress values ​​of each grid in the cladding tube do not reach the yield point, it is determined that the cladding tube has not undergone plastic deformation. In this case, when calculating the total deformation of the inner wall of the cladding tube, only the elastic deformation needs to be calculated. Furthermore, after determining that the stress value of the inner wall of the cladding tube has reached the yield point, it is necessary to further determine whether the cladding tube has fractured. If the cladding tube has fractured, the calculation process ends. If the cladding tube has not fractured, the process returns to continuously updating the pressure load, and the steps of obtaining the deformation of the inner and outer walls of the cladding tube and the stress values ​​of each grid of the cladding tube at that time (assuming the previous update time is t, then t = t + dt) under each updated pressure load are repeated cyclically.
